Oracle数据库事务处理异常:问题示例及解决方法

原创 心已赠人 2025-01-29 22:00 42阅读 0赞

在Oracle数据库中,事务处理是原子性和一致性的重要保障。如果出现事务处理异常,可能的原因和解决方法如下:

  1. 事务未提交或已回滚:

    • 解决:确保在事务开始前正确调用了BEGIN TRANSACTION;
    • 如果是在触发器或存储过程内部出现的问题,需要检查相应的代码逻辑。
  2. 数据库空间不足:

    • 解决:清理不必要的数据,或者增加数据库的空间配置。
  3. SQL语句语法错误:

    • 解决:仔细审查SQL语句,确保所有的语法和标点符号都正确无误。
  4. 事务并发问题:

    • 解决:如果在高并发环境下出现事务异常,可能需要使用乐观锁、悲观锁等机制来控制并发访问,或者调整数据库的配置以提高并发处理能力。
文章版权声明:注明蒲公英云原创文章,转载或复制请以超链接形式并注明出处。

发表评论

表情:
评论列表 (有 0 条评论,42人围观)

还没有评论,来说两句吧...

相关阅读